Stan here from Scotland, needing a bit of help with my EJ6 1997 Civic Coupe.

It currently has a D16Y7, but i have a JDM D15B sitting here with a shot bottom end.

I have ECU and loom from the D15B.

I going to attempt a mini-me swap, but just have a couple questions....

Which ECU will i use? (Will the P08 JDM D15B ECU work? - And will it plug in and at least run?)

I gather my EJ6 will be OBDII (as it is a 1997), is this correct?

you will need an obd1-obd2a jumper harness to run that ecu. found at pherable.net or rywire.com. you need to use the stock harness for that car because 96-00 civic have 1 piece harness were as obd1 civic use 2 piece. good luck

unless you swap intake manifolds you are going to have to wire up the 2 wire IACV as the Y7 has a 3 wire. Also you'll be going from a 4 wire O2 to a 1 wire O2. The easiest thing would be just use the exhaust manifold from your Y7 as well and you won't need to wire anything for the O2.
